开发者社区> 问答> 正文

FLINK是如何做到heap内存管理?

我们公司现在也在研究flink,流计算方面的框架,我们现在用的是基于postgres内核的pipelineDB,不过有很多问题。
阿里的blink会open source?

展开
收起
桑木乐 2016-07-19 21:38:26 3608 0
1 条回答
写回答
取消 提交回答
  • 离线计算存储团队blink项目开发人员

    如果是batch job需要sort这种排序需求的,内存排序会使用框架的内存管理,这样效率更高,不会OOM, 网络shuffle过程上下游之间的数据传输buffer也是基于内存管理实现的,这样一是保证内存可控,同时也实现了流控反压机制,这里的内存管理可以使用heap也可以使用non-heap都是可配置的

    2019-07-17 19:58:39
    赞同 1 展开评论 打赏
问答排行榜
最热
最新

相关电子书

更多
Flink CDC Meetup PPT - 龚中强 立即下载
Flink CDC Meetup PPT - 王赫 立即下载
Flink CDC Meetup PPT - 覃立辉 立即下载